Opening Width and Height — What Determines Door Selection in Winfield

The opening width is measured from the inside face of the finished jamb on each side in Winfield, WV. Standard residential door widths of 8, 9, 10, 16, and 18 feet accommodate most residential openings in Winfield. An opening that doesn't match a standard width within manufacturer tolerance requires a custom-manufactured door in Winfield, WV. The opening height determines the correct door height and the available headroom above the door in Winfield.

Headroom Clearance — The Constraint That Drives Track Choice in Winfield, WV

Headroom is the distance from the top of the door opening to the ceiling or the lowest obstruction above it in Winfield. Standard radius track requires approximately 10 to 12 inches of headroom in Winfield, WV. Low-headroom track configurations accommodate spaces with as little as 6 to 8 inches in Winfield. This measurement is the first constraint that determines which track configurations are even possible for the specific installation in Winfield, WV.

Side Room — The Minimum for Standard Hardware in Winfield

Standard torsion spring installations require approximately 3.75 inches of side room on each side of the opening for the vertical track and the end bearing plate in Winfield, WV. Less than this on either side means the standard configuration can't be installed without modification in Winfield.

Header Framing — The Load Capacity Requirement in Winfield, WV

The torsion spring assembly is mounted to the header framing above the door opening in Winfield. The header must have adequate load capacity for this assembly in Winfield, WV. A correctly sized residential header, typically a doubled 2x10 or 2x12 for standard openings, has adequate capacity in most cases in Winfield. A converted carport, a widened opening, or an originally undersized header may not in Winfield, WV.

Electrical Access for the Opener in Winfield

The opener requires a 120-volt electrical outlet within approximately 6 feet of the motor unit in Winfield, WV. In a new garage build, this is typically part of the electrical rough-in in Winfield. In a converted space, the outlet may not exist at the needed location in Winfield, WV. EZ Open confirms electrical access during the assessment and advises on any electrical work needed before the installation date in Winfield.

Door Weight Determination — The Foundation Variable in Winfield

The new door's weight is calculated from its width, height, steel gauge, insulation type and R-value, and window section configuration in Winfield, WV. The manufacturer's specification sheet for the selected door provides the weight for the specific size and construction combination in Winfield. This calculated weight is the foundation for every other specification that follows in Winfield, WV.

Spring Specification Matched to the New Door's Actual Weight in Winfield

The spring must be specified for the new door's calculated weight, not estimated, not assumed based on a similar-looking previous door in Winfield, WV. Wire diameter, inside diameter, length, and winding turn count are all calculated from the new door's weight, height, and cable drum configuration in Winfield.

Track Configuration Selected for the Available Headroom in Winfield, WV

The track configuration, standard, low-headroom, or high-lift, is selected based on the available headroom measured during the assessment in Winfield. This selection also affects the correct spring winding calculation, since the turn count depends on the door's travel distance within the specific track configuration in Winfield, WV.

Opener Capacity Matched to the Door in Winfield

The opener must have adequate rated capacity for the calculated door weight in Winfield, WV. An opener selected without this matching may run at or above its design load on every cycle, accumulating wear faster than intended from the first day of use in Winfield.

The Balance Test — Confirming Everything Was Done Correctly in Winfield, WV

Once the door is hung and the springs are wound to the calculated turn count, EZ Open disconnects the opener and manually raises the door to the halfway position in Winfield. A correctly specified and wound spring produces a door that holds its position near the halfway height when released in Winfield, WV. This test confirms the door weight calculation, the spring specification, and the winding were all correct before the opener is connected and the installation is considered complete in Winfield.

Standard Steel — Reliable and Cost-Effective in Winfield

Standard steel doors in single or double-layer construction are the most common residential choice, available in raised panel and flush panel profiles in Winfield, WV. Appropriate where thermal performance isn't the primary consideration in Winfield.

Insulated Steel — The Right Choice for Attached Garages in Winfield, WV

Insulated steel doors with polystyrene or polyurethane core construction significantly reduce thermal transfer compared to uninsulated steel in Winfield. Polyurethane-insulated doors also operate more quietly because the foam core absorbs vibration in Winfield, WV. Available in R-values from R-6 to R-18 and above in Winfield.

Carriage House Style in Winfield, WV

Carriage house style doors use an overhead sectional mechanism with a traditional swing-door appearance, popular for craftsman, colonial, and farmhouse architectural styles in Winfield. Available in a wide range of panel configurations and window options in Winfield, WV.

Contemporary and Full-View Glass in Winfield

Contemporary doors with flush panels, aluminum frames, and full-view glass sections suit modern and mid-century architectural styles in Winfield, WV. Significantly heavier than steel panel doors, requiring specific spring, opener, and track assessment in Winfield.
